Output 38b5006d6d9edee9615f4f1c1c697f3205a25da3e1ab8e6d45a31abf36fd90e0:0

value
95890667
script pubkey
OP_0 OP_PUSHBYTES_20 e0ef37cb0058594a9ea11d2c650f5a62e3602d23
address
bc1qurhn0jcqtpv5484pr5kx2r66vt3kqtfrtvmkkd
transaction
38b5006d6d9edee9615f4f1c1c697f3205a25da3e1ab8e6d45a31abf36fd90e0